Abstract
The reaction has been measured at an incident energy of 20 MeV. Differential cross sections were measured at 13 angles and an excitation range of 5 MeV was observed with 18 keV resolution. The data are compared to distorted wave calculations both for assignments and magnitude relations. Sixteen new levels are reported in as well as many new limits on spin assignments. An interpretation of the results as a proton hole coupled to pairing-multipole states is presented. Such an analysis provides a qualitative description of the observed strength, but a more complex analysis is required for quantitative results.
